Comprehending Triple Glazing
Triple Glazing Upgrades glazing refers to windows made up of 3 panes of glass, separated by insulating areas filled with inert gases such as argon or krypton. This design considerably improves a window's thermal performance compared to single or double glazing. Let's break down the crucial components of triple glazing:
ComponentDescriptionPanes of GlassThree different sheets of glass for included insulationSpacer BarsSections that hold the panes apart, lessening heat transferInert GasArgon or krypton gas used in the gap to lower heat flowCoatingsLow-emissivity (Low-E) finishings enhance energy effectivenessBenefits of Triple Glazing
The benefits of triple glazing extend far beyond energy effectiveness. Here is an in-depth list identifying the considerable advantages:

Superior Insulation: Triple glazing offers exceptional heat retention in winter season and keeps homes cooler in summertime.

Energy Savings: Homeowners can anticipate minimized energy bills as cooling and heating systems do not need to work as difficult.

Noise Reduction: The extra panes decrease outside noise substantially, boosting indoor serenity.

Condensation Control: Improved thermal efficiency lessens the opportunities of condensation on the glass.

Increased Comfort: A steady indoor environment enhances comfort throughout severe weather.

Boosted Security: The extra layer of glass provides an additional barrier versus trespassers.

Residential Or Commercial Property Value Increase: Homes fitted with triple glazing can see an increase in property worth due to improved energy effectiveness scores.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)1. What is the difference between double and triple glazing?
Double glazing includes two panes of glass, while triple Budget-Friendly Glazing has 3. Triple glazing provides better insulation and energy efficiency compared to double glazing due to the extra glass layer and gas fill.
2. Are triple glazed windows worth the investment?
While the preliminary cost of triple-glazed windows is typically higher than double-glazed options, they supply considerable long-term cost savings on energy bills and can improve residential or commercial property worth, making them a worthwhile financial investment.
3. Just how much energy can I conserve with triple glazing?
Energy cost savings can vary based on area, home type, and energy usage. However, homes with Affordable Triple Glazing glazing can conserve between 20% to 40% on heating expenses compared to homes with single or double glazing.
4. Do triple glazed windows lower sound?
Yes, triple glazing substantially reduces outside noise. The additional glass layer combined with the insulating gas helps dampen sound waves, making it an exceptional option for properties in busy or loud locations.
5. How do I preserve triple glazed windows?
Maintenance for triple glazed windows is comparable to that of double-glazed windows. Routine cleaning with non-abrasive solutions, periodic checks for seal integrity, and guaranteeing drainage channels are clear are crucial elements of maintenance.
